(Full website users only) Connecting your domain name to your Making Music Platform

Note: this help guide does not apply to Making Music Platform users that are using the "members area only" sites.  This only applies to sites that have a public-facing website. 

When groups get a Making Music Platform for the first time, they are set up with a template website hosted at a private makingmusicplatform.com website address.  Groups add content to their new Making Music Platform, and eventually deem it to be "ready" - ready for launch to their members and supporters.  In other words, they are ready to connect their domain name, and make their new Making Music Platform "live".

For example, let's say your group's name is "Example Group", your domain name is 'examplegroup.com', and that your Making Music Platform was created at 'examplegroup.makingmusicplatform.com.'  When your new Making Music Platform is ready for launch, you want to connect the domain name 'examplegroup.com' to your Making Music Platform, so that when someone visits 'examplegroup.com', they are taken to the new Making Music Platform.  After that happens, your Making Music Platform will be able to be find via two web addresses, 'examplegroup.com' and 'examplegroup.makingmusicplatform.com.'

How to do it

Note that if we (Making Music) manage your domain name, then we will do  this for you. All you need to do is tell us when you're ready for it to happen, please see our FAQ on domain name management for important information about how to co-ordinate going live (connecting your domain name to your platform) and setting up Making Music to manage your domain name. If we are not your domain name provider, then read on...

To connect your domain name to your new Making Music Platform website, you need to log into the website of your domain name provider - the website where your domain name was registered and is now managed and renewed.  If you don't know who your domain name provider is, then contact us - we may be able to find out for you.  Once logged in, you need to locate the place where you change your domain name's "nameservers".  This is sometimes called "delegation".  The place where you change nameservers is different in every domain name provider's website.  Once you've located the place where nameservers are changed, replace any existing nameservers with the following...

  • ns1mm.harmonysite.com
  • ns2mm.harmonysite.com

...and then wait several hours for that change to take effect.  Please also let us (Making Music) know as soon as the change has been made, so that we can update our records.
